About this role
We’re looking for a strong Senior React Engineer to join our engineering team. This role is ideal for someone who thrives in building enterprise level, production applications and has deep experience in developing server-side rendered (SSR) React applications.
You’ll work alongside Tech Leads, Product Owners, UX Designers and Server-side Engineers to deliver performant, resilient, and scalable web components that provide life-changing financial services to millions of customers across the globe. We’re looking for someone that cares deeply about code quality, foundational design principles, working collaboratively across teams and feels empowered to share their opinions in conversations.
What You’ll Do
Build and maintain enterprise-scale React applications with a focus on performance, scalability, and maintainabilityDevelop full stack, server-side rendered (SSR) applications using modern React patternsWork with frameworks such as React Router, Next.js, Remix, or TanStack Router (or similar)Collaborate cross-functionally to translate product requirements into robust technical solutionsContribute to architectural decisions and help evolve our frontend and full stack patternsWrite clean, thoroughly tested and well-documented codeParticipate in code reviews and mentor junior engineers where appropriateSupport CI/CD processes and production deployments and application support. What We’re Looking For
5+ years of professional software engineering experience.Strong proficiency in React and modern JavaScript/TypeScript.Experience building full stack, server-side rendered React applications.Hands-on experience with one or more of the following:React RouterNext.jsRemixTanStack RouterSolid understanding of web fundamentals (Caching, performance optimization, accessibility, OAuth, etc).Experience designing and consuming REST & GraphQL APIs.Familiarity with testing frameworks (e.g., Jest, React Testing Library, Cypress).Hands-on experience with Copilot/ChatGPT/Claude as a coding assistant, prompt engineering and evaluation of AI output quality.Experience working on an Agile engineering team (Jira, Sprints, etc)Nice to Haves
Design and implement APIs and backend integrations to support frontend experiences.Experience with Node.js backend development.Working knowledge of AWS (Lambdas, Fargate, S3, RDS, etc.).Experience collaborating with designers using modern design tools (e.g., Figma) and design-to-code workflows, including leveraging AI tooling and automation to accelerate UI development and iteration.Experience developing AI-driven workflows, including handling edge cases, what a trust signal is, and designing fallback patterns.Working knowledge of how to utilize and filter data with observability and monitoring tools.Experience working in heavily regulated financial environments.What Success Looks Like
You can independently own features from technical design through production releaseYou write code that scales across teams and use casesYou proactively identify and resolve performance and architectural bottlenecksYou elevate engineering standards through thoughtful reviews and collaboration Our uniqueness is that we celebrate yours. Experian's culture and people are important differentiators. We take our people agenda very seriously and focus on what matters; DEI, work/life balance, development, authenticity, collaboration, wellness, reward & recognition, volunteering... the list goes on. Experian's people first approach is award-winning; World's Best Workplaces™ 2024 (Fortune Top 25), Great Place To Work™ in 24 countries, and Glassdoor Best Places to Work 2024 to name a few. Check out Experian Life on social or our Careers Site to understand why.
Experian is proud to be an Equal Opportunity and Affirmative Action employer. Innovation is an important part of Experian's DNA and practices, and our diverse workforce drives our success. Everyone can succeed at Experian and bring their whole self to work, irrespective of their gender, ethnicity, religion, colour, sexuality, physical ability or age. If you have a disability or special need that requires accommodation, please let us know at the earliest opportunity.
